I. Core Equipment Advantages
This 5500T large horizontal aluminum extrusion press is Hengda Machinery's flagship equipment for high-end, large-section, high-precision, high-strength aluminum profile production. It integrates top-tier hydraulic, electrical, and sealing components from international brands, combined with pre-stressed structural design and intelligent control systems. Its outstanding overall performance includes the following core advantages:

 

1. High-strength pre-stressed frame for stable operation and high precision. The equipment uses a full pre-stressed frame structure, optimized through 3D finite element stress analysis, significantly reducing elastic deformation during extrusion. The machine maintains high alignment accuracy and rigidity, resisting deformation under long-term heavy loads to ensure stable dimensional tolerances. The main plunger is wear-resistant and durable, extending overall service life.

 2. Top-tier hydraulic components for powerful output and low failure rate, meeting the demands of large-tonnage, high-difficulty profile extrusion. The machine comes standard with a plate-type cooling system for stable temperature control, supporting continuous long-term production. 

3. Intelligent electrical control system with high automation and easy operation. The electrical system uses internationally renowned components with full-auto/semi-auto/manual multi-mode cycle control. Extrusion speed is steplessly adjustable, container temperature control accuracy is within ±5°C, and operating data such as oil temperature and level are displayed in real time for intuitive HMI interaction. The equipment includes comprehensive safety interlocks and emergency stop systems to prevent operator error and significantly enhance production safety. 

4. Short-stroke + rear-loading design for excellent productivity. The classic short-stroke, moving stem, rear-loading billet structure, combined with a servo-driven billet loader, ensures precise and efficient billet feeding. The non-extrusion cycle time is short with tight process sequencing, significantly improving productivity over conventional models. Equipped with a cassette-type dual die holder quick-change mechanism, in-die shear, and independent residual knocking structure, die changes, shearing, and maintenance are more convenient, effectively reducing downtime and increasing overall capacity. 

5. Broad alloy compatibility. The equipment stably processes 1-8 series aluminum alloys, covering building profiles, industrial profiles, and high-strength specialty aluminum. The container, stem, and die components use high-end alloy tool steels such as H13 and 5CrNiMo, all inspected and qualified for heat resistance and wear resistance, suitable for long-cycle, high-load production conditions.

 

II. Applicable Products

With 5500T of extrusion force, large-format capacity, and high precision, this equipment produces large-section, thick-wall, high-strength, complex-cross-section aluminum profiles, covering civil, industrial, new energy, transportation, and other major sectors. Product categories include: 

1. Large building curtain wall & structural profiles – large curtain wall profiles, building load-bearing frames, large window/door frames, engineering structural aluminum components, suitable for large commercial buildings, landmark projects, and prefabricated construction.

2. New energy vehicle lightweight profiles – battery trays, body beams, crash beams, chassis structural parts, large frame profiles, meeting automakers' strict requirements for high strength, lightweight, and high dimensional accuracy

3. Rail transit profiles – high-speed rail and subway car body structural parts, carriage frames, large rail accessory aluminum profiles with dense internal structure, fatigue resistance, and strong load-bearing capacity, meeting heavy-duty and high-safety rail standards. 

4. Solar & energy storage profiles – large PV brackets, solar panel frames, energy storage cabinet frames, storage structure aluminum profiles with excellent surface quality and corrosion resistance for long-term outdoor use. 

5. General large industrial profiles – large equipment frames, automation line main beams, engineering machinery structural parts, large aluminum bars, thick-wall hollow tubes, and complex special-shaped industrial profiles. 

6. High-end specialty aluminum products – 2-series, 7-series high-strength aerospace-grade aluminum profiles, marine structural profiles, large electrical conductive bars, and other high-end specialty profiles for military, marine engineering, and high-end equipment manufacturing.
